Dynamic and Fluid Dynamic Characteristics of a Fuel Injection Nozzle.

Abstract

Due to the increasing requirements for reduced emissions from internal combustion engines many manufacturers have expressed interest in gasoline fuel injection systems. In order to determine the fluid dynamic and dynamic characteristics of a commercial injector a test chamber was constructed and a laboratory simulation carried out. A proposed method of predicting flow rates and dynamic response has been compared with experimental results. (Author)
